Autopsy set in Youngstown fire

YOUNGSTOWN — The Mahoning County Coroner’s Office identified the woman who died in an early Sunday morning house fire at Crandall and Ford avenues as Karen Phillips, 49.

A news release from coroner’s investigator Theresa Valek states an autopsy of Phillips will be conducted by the Cuyahoga County Medical Examiner’s Office.

A fire department report states Phillips was trapped on the third floor of the home about 1:30 a.m., while three other people inside the home made it out alive. The report states Phillips was revived at the scene but later died at St. Elizabeth Youngstown Hospital.

The state fire marshal was called in to help with the investigation, the coroner’s release states.
